After a recent run of successes, AWAL has announced a series of executive promotions in the U.K.
Matt Riley has been named president, an elevation from his previous role of managing director. Meanwhile, Victoria Needs and Sam Potts will move into new roles as co-managing directors, having both previously held the role of senior vp.
Riley, who appeared on Billboard U.K.’s 2025 Power Players list, first joined the label and distributor in 2014 and has led the U.K. arm of the label since 2023 alongside Needs and Potts. Prior to joining AWAL, Needs held roles at EMI, Warner and Sony. Her current team has led global campaigns for artists such as Djo, Little Simz, Jungle and Laufey, as well as delivering domestic success for artists such as CMAT and James Marriott. Potts has enjoyed success while working on the digital marketing strategies for AWAL’s roster.
The news follows a hot streak in the U.K. for the AWAL roster. In June, Marriott hit the top spot of the Official Albums Chart with his second LP, Don’t Tell The Dog, besting Oasis in a tight chart battle. And AWAL-affiliated rapper and polymath Little Simz achieved a new career-high on the U.K. Albums Chart with her sixth album Lotus peaking at No. 3 while marking her biggest opening-week sales to date. Following her curation of London’s Meltdown Festival in June, she’s due to headline London’s O2 Arena this fall.
Irish country-pop star CMAT drew a huge crowd at Glastonbury Festival in June, and AWAL is set to release her third LP, Euro-Country, on Aug. 29. Her song “Take a Sexy Picture of Me” has earned 18 million streams since its release in May and sparked a viral TikTok dance. Additionally, Icelandic-Chinese star Laufey earned a hat-trick of top 40 singles in 2024 with three festive songs (“Winter Wonderland,” “Christmas Magic,” and “Santa Baby”) charting in the U.K. Her third LP, A Matter of Time, will be released on Aug. 22.
